    Hangtimes with Roadrunner

    This problem has been occuring for about 2 months now, I have gone all but insane with dealing with the Roadrunner "specialist technicians". And I guess the real kicker is that this problem is interminent.. but let me explain.

    I run a netgear rt314, three computers access a Surfboard cablemodem that is routed. On all three computers, (all network settings are set properly to my knowledge) occassionally either while first accessing or during the use of any internet application there will be a 5 second to 3.5 minute "hang time" where there is no out going or incoming data, I have no clue as to what could be causing this.. any suggestions or similiar stories out there?

    I am assuming this happens on all the computers, otherwise you would have said it was only happening on one. I would also assume that there is no problem with RR in your area, otherwise the Specialist tech should have known about it, though not always the case. After all my assumptions, seeings some more info from you would have been helpful, I would also have to assume that the problem is in your rt314 router. Try plugging just one of the computers directly to the modem and see if the problem persists. If the problem goes away, then you know it is in your router, get a new one. If not, then you know it is in the modem, assuming all you network configs are correct.
